What can a Roth IRA do for you? – Vanguard
Friday, July 23rd, 2010Learn the benefits of investing in a Roth IRA. In this Vanguard® Plain Talk on Investing™ video, Joel Dickson of Vanguard’s Quantitative Equity Group explains that Roth IRAs give you the potential for tax-free growth while you’re saving for retirement and tax-free withdrawals after you’ve retired—when it matters the most.
